ubuntu 8.04 安装时最后grub install 致命错误 [已解决]

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
sfz97308
帖子: 24
注册时间: 2008-01-31 12:19

ubuntu 8.04 安装时最后grub install 致命错误 [已解决]

#1

帖子 sfz97308 » 2008-05-18 20:10

此问题我以自己解决,请参照我的方案:
viewtopic.php?p=764102#764102


ubuntu 8.04 安装时最后grub install 致命错误
看到坛子上有人说是没有swap区,但我是有的。
有人说安装到其他分区,而不是安装到MBR上就行,可是,我都试过,无论是(hd0)还是(hd0,9)还是/dev/sda10,都不行。

以前ubuntu7.10很正常,这8.04反而出现这么奇怪的“致命错误”

另外,我在livecd上恢复安装了grub到hd(0,9),通过easybcd正常引导了grub,不过是grub的命令行,而没有菜单。
谁能提供下一步的解决方案?????

别因为这个让我走向fedora9啊!!!!!
上次由 sfz97308 在 2008-05-23 22:07,总共编辑 1 次。
sheji
帖子: 431
注册时间: 2008-04-30 21:40

#2

帖子 sheji » 2008-05-18 20:42

刚好给我看到这个帖子。

清除硬盘所有根目录的menu.lst文件,或拖入任意一个文件夹中。
最好清空一下MBR。(不清空也不要紧,看着办)

以我的经验,应该能够解决你的问题。
sfz97308
帖子: 24
注册时间: 2008-01-31 12:19

#3

帖子 sfz97308 » 2008-05-18 20:45

sheji 写了:刚好给我看到这个帖子。

清除硬盘所有根目录的menu.lst文件,或拖入任意一个文件夹中。
最好清空一下MBR。(不清空也不要紧,看着办)

以我的经验,应该能够解决你的问题。
显然没有效果。
我倒是通过自己从livecd安装grub和自己写menu.lst成功引导ubuntu了
不过,很显然ubuntu的安装尚未完成,界面还都是英文,中文也没装
ubuntu8.04 你的失误太严重!想说爱你不容易!
sheji
帖子: 431
注册时间: 2008-04-30 21:40

#4

帖子 sheji » 2008-05-18 21:37

你已经又安装过了?这么短的时间似乎不大可能。

不能引导,是因为没有写入MBR或者是选定的分区,提示信息是致命错误。
不能成功引导(不能进入界面,或进入的是英文)是因为安装出错(设备读写以及文件本身错误),也有UUID识别错误的可能。这些我都经历过。
sheji
帖子: 431
注册时间: 2008-04-30 21:40

#5

帖子 sheji » 2008-05-18 21:43

我现在可以用U盘、任意盘启动到grub,从grub来引导任意分区的ubuntu、win2k3、win2K、XPE等。成功启动ubuntu的关键,是看uuid对不对,它不仅会变,而且和安装里的uuid记录不一致!

不能安装引导,目前发现的问题,除了MBR原因,就是根目录含有menu.lst文件。
头像
oliver258
帖子: 105
注册时间: 2007-12-28 6:43

#6

帖子 oliver258 » 2008-05-23 10:04

网上搜了半天也没找到这个问题的解决方法,我安装的时候就碰到了这个问题.不知道2楼的兄弟说的有没有效果,回头我试试.
sfz97308
帖子: 24
注册时间: 2008-01-31 12:19

#7

帖子 sfz97308 » 2008-05-23 22:07

此问题我以自己解决,请参照我的方案:
viewtopic.php?p=764102#764102
sheji
帖子: 431
注册时间: 2008-04-30 21:40

#8

帖子 sheji » 2008-05-24 17:15

sfz97308 写了:此问题我以自己解决,请参照我的方案:
viewtopic.php?p=764102#764102
看了你的这个成功解决的办法的链接,,,我不知道说什么好了,,,因为你的方法就是我所说的。

第一,你说的分区“格式”问题。不赞同。
第二,你的启动菜单没有成功建立,就是“因某原因”没能做好grub引导。什么原因呢?你没给出,我也不想再重复。(不想提你的BCD有什么问题)
第三,UUID不对,变了、或者根本就没有建立。你手工建立了。
你的方法只适合于手工修复,还得有一定的功底,不能说是解决了安装的问题,只能说是你解决了自己的引导问题。
回复